 In our conversation today, Megan shares her journey of healing and restoration. She reflects on the highlights of attending a Baton Pass event and the power of vulnerability. She then shares her personal story of facing health challenges, including a battle with breast implant illness. Through prayer and a miraculous turn of events, Megan underwent surgery with the hope of healing. She recounts her experiences after the surgery and her overall well-being. Megan also discusses her trust in God during the difficult times and encourages others to pour out their hearts to Him. Currently, Megan understands the importance of obedience and how it leads to a deeper relationship with God.
